Headteacher Update Podcast: Supporting Pupil Premium and disadvantaged children
Description
In this episode, three schools talk about the impact of the cost of living crisis and their work to support Pupil Premium and disadvantaged pupils.
Our guests identify their key tenets of effective Pupil Premium practice and talk about specific approaches they are using in their schools. We delve into a range of strategies and ideas for addressing the consequences of poverty in the primary school, including tips for success and lessons learned.
We hear about what is happening on the ground in our guests’ schools and the particular impacts they are seeing of the cost of living crisis and increasing levels of poverty.
We look at different aspects of school life through the lens of poverty, including the day-to-day running of the school, curriculum design, wider school systems, and more.
We discuss how to track Pupil Premium interventions and strategies, how to evaluate our spending, and the key ingredients of an effective, high-impact Pupil Premium Strategy.
Other topics under discussion include pupil voice, raising aspiration, attendance, quality first teaching and more.
